Symptoms

  • •Vibrations felt through the steering wheel or seat
  • •Increased noise levels at higher speeds
  • •Vehicle feels unstable or difficult to control
  • •Possible pulling to one side when driving straight
  • •Uneven tire wear observed

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a level surface.
  • Engage the parking brake.
  • If applicable, disconnect the battery.
2. Tire Inspection and Pressure Check
  • Remove wheel covers if present.
  • Use a tire pressure gauge to check each tire's pressure; inflate to the recommended PSI if necessary.
  • Inspect tires for bulges, cracks, or uneven wear.
3. Wheel Balancing
  • Lift the vehicle using a jack and secure it with jack stands.
  • Remove the wheels from the vehicle.
  • Mount each wheel on a wheel balancing machine and adjust weights as necessary to achieve balance.
  • Reinstall the balanced wheels.
4. Suspension Inspection
  • Visually inspect shock absorbers, struts, bushings, and control arms for signs of wear or damage.
  • Replace any worn or damaged components following manufacturer specifications.
5. Driveshaft and CV Joint Inspection
  • Inspect the driveshaft for any visible damage or play.
  • Check CV joints for grease leakage or wear.
  • Replace any damaged driveshaft or CV joints as needed.
6. Final Assembly
  • Reinstall wheels and torque lug nuts to manufacturer specifications (typically 80-100 ft-lbs).
  • Lower the vehicle and recheck tire pressure.
  • Reconnect the battery if it was disconnected.
